Output 5064a73d1076959c79ef60900a09dced6f9d536006fbca61e17af8c318da69bd:0

value
31648945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08731f020206d961048f69a74fabec851c997561 OP_EQUAL
address
M8fqYikxmu7TPHvEkVQpN8K8xkJZBqu6mL
transaction
5064a73d1076959c79ef60900a09dced6f9d536006fbca61e17af8c318da69bd
spent
true